Transaction 0852cf9d957f113e71a22ea5d39ac2c08a32e17e2f05fbc6df69bfc2b0b26685
1 Input
1 Output
-
0852cf9d957f113e71a22ea5d39ac2c08a32e17e2f05fbc6df69bfc2b0b26685:0
- value
- 426608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1391ed90545efece684b93d12d02491e3c82250e OP_EQUAL
- address
- 33UVaSd6d6kVLY36vkuh1RdzY1az9RH6Mz